Are Florida statutes who protects mentally ill murders?

Florida Statutes do not "protect" mentally ill people who commit crimes. What they do is prevent inappropriate punishment of people who can be shown to be incapable of making competent decisions. This is, admittedly, a matter of opinion. However, the opinions reflected in Florida law tend to prevail across the country.

What type of law is statute law?

STATUTE - A law established by an act of the legislature. Under the U.S. and state constitutions, statutes are considered the primary source of law in the U.S. -- that is, the legislatures make the law (statutes) - the executive branch enforces the law - and courts interpret the law (cases).
